Helpful Tips for First-Timers
If you’re new to making crispy chicken at home, don’t worry. A light dusting of cornstarch and flour goes a long way. Make sure your oil is hot enough before frying, and don’t overcrowd the pan. Remember—easy recipes are about enjoying the process as much as the result!


Easy Sesame Chicken Stir Fry Recipe
Ingredients
- 2 boneless, skinless chicken breasts, cut into bite-size pieces
- 1/2 tsp salt
- 1/2 tsp white pepper
- 1/2 tsp garlic powder
- 1/2 tsp onion powder
- 1 egg
- 1/2 cup cornstarch
- 1/4 cup all-purpose flour
- 2 tbsp vegetable oil (for frying)
- 1/3 cup low-sodium soy sauce
- 1/4 cup honey
- 2 tbsp brown sugar
- 2 tbsp rice vinegar
- 2 cloves garlic, minced
- 1 tbsp grated ginger
- 1 tbsp cornstarch + 2 tbsp water (slurry)
- 1 tbsp sesame oil
- Toasted sesame seeds for garnish
- Chopped scallions for garnish
- Cooked white rice, for serving
Instructions
- In a bowl, mix the chicken with salt, white pepper, garlic powder, onion powder, and the egg.
- Add cornstarch and flour to the bowl and mix until the chicken is evenly coated.
- Heat oil in a skillet over medium-high heat. Fry chicken in batches until golden and crispy. Set aside.
- In a saucepan, combine soy sauce, honey, brown sugar, rice vinegar, garlic, and ginger.
- Bring the sauce to a simmer, then stir in the cornstarch slurry. Simmer until thickened.
- Add sesame oil and stir well.
- Toss the crispy chicken in the sauce until well coated.
- Serve over white rice and garnish with sesame seeds and chopped scallions.
